Transaction dedbaa7c60908770e20d741e5bdfd9b1608e85233472643d5e25bf91ba304cb5
1 Input
2 Outputs
- dedbaa7c60908770e20d741e5bdfd9b1608e85233472643d5e25bf91ba304cb5:0
- dedbaa7c60908770e20d741e5bdfd9b1608e85233472643d5e25bf91ba304cb5:1
value 17225668
address 1NogEZzh5YdAgqFF8K3RSfRCB7U8Mc5BLS
value 57762
address bc1q4hn8rywnwhdxxhhnvmrleh6r430enzr3ykucxg